Jesus, Thou art my Righteousness

Hymnal: Book of Worship (Rev. ed.) #319 (1870) Meter: 8.6.8.6 Lyrics: 1 Jesus, Thou art my Righteousness, For all my sins were Thine: Thy death hath bought of God my peace, Thy life hath made Him mine. 2 Now justified in Thee I am; My sins are all forgiven: I taste salvation in Thy Name, And antedate my heaven. 3 Believing on my Lord, I find A sure and present aid: On Thee alone my constant mind Be every moment stay'd. 4 Whate'er in me seems wise, or good, Or strong, I here disclaim: I wash my garments in the blood Of the atoning Lamb. 5 Jesus, my Strength, my Life, my Rest, On Thee will I depend, Till summoned to the marriage-feast, Where faith in sight shall end. Topics: Christ our Righteousness; Faith Justification by; Faith In Christ; Faith Blessedness of; Forgiveness Of Sin; Happiness of pardon and justification; Justification by Faith; Pardon; Peace Personal; Righteousness Christ our; Salvation By faith Languages: English

Jesus, Thou art my Righteousness

Author: C. Wesley Hymnal: Church Book #370 (1890) Meter: 8.6.8.6 Lyrics: 1 Jesus, Thou art my Righteousness, For all my sins were Thine: Thy Death hath bought of God my peace, Thy life hath made Him mine. 2 For ever here my rest shall be, Close to Thy bleeding side; This all my hope and all my plea: For me the Saviour died. 3 My dying Saviour and my God, Fountain for guilt and sin, Sprinkle me ever with Thy Blood, And cleanse, and keep me lean. 4 The Atonement of Thy Blood apply, Till faith to sight improve; Till hope in full fruition die, And all my soul be love. Topics: The Order of Salvation Faith and Justification; Sundays in Lent; Lent, Second Sunday; Lent, Fifth Sunday; Passion Week; Nineteenth Sunday after Trinity Languages: English Tune Title: ST. MARY'S
